Davey Microlene KAS20JM — Whole House Water Filter for Mains Water
Cleaner, better-tasting water at every tap — with longer cartridge life.
The Davey Microlene KAS20JM is a 2-stage whole-house filter kit designed specifically for mains water. It removes sediment from your supply in the first stage, then treats taste and odour in the second — so the water reaching your taps is clear, fresh, and free of the chlorine smell common in mains supplies.
The kit uses 20" Jumbo housings. Longer than the 10" version, these housings hold more cartridge media — which means higher capacity between changes and a recommended max flow rate of 155 LPM. Well suited to larger homes, high-usage households, or properties where the 10" kit would need servicing too frequently. If your property has very high flow demands, two kits can be installed in parallel.
Connection fittings are not included. The housings use 25mm (1") FBSP connections — standard NZ plumbing size.
How It Works
Stage 1 — 5 Micron Poly Spun Cartridge
Removes fine sediment found in mains water supplies.
Stage 2 — 5 Micron Carbon Block Cartridge
Treats taste and odour, including chlorine common in town supply water.
Key Specs at a Glance
- Housing size: 20" Jumbo (114mm / 4.5" OD cartridges)
- Water source: Mains water
- Connections: 25mm (1") FBSP
- Recommended max flow: 155 LPM
- Max system pressure: 880 kPa (128 PSI)
- Water temperature: 0–40°C
- Cartridge life: Replace every 6–12 months
- Housing material: Glass reinforced polypropylene
- Compliance: Tested to AS/NZS 4020 for use in contact with drinking water

Frequently Asked Questions
Is this suitable for mains water only?
Yes. The KAS20JM is configured specifically for mains water — the cartridge combination addresses the sediment, taste, and odour characteristics of town supply. If you're on rainwater, get in touch and we'll recommend the right configuration.
What's the difference between the KAS10JM and KAS20JM?
Both use the same housing diameter (114mm OD cartridges) and the same cartridge combination. The 20" version uses longer cartridges, which increases capacity and extends the time between changes. It also supports a higher recommended max flow rate — 155 LPM vs 125 LPM for the 10". If you have a larger household or higher usage, the 20" is the better fit.
Do I need a plumber to install it?
For most customers, yes — a licensed plumber is the safest path and protects your warranty on the plumbing side. The KAS20JM uses standard 25mm (1") FBSP connections and wall-mounts with the included fixings. If you're confident with household plumbing, the installation itself is straightforward. What connection fittings will I need?
The housings have 25mm (1") FBSP connections. Connection fittings are not included — your plumber can supply these from any plumbing merchant.
How often do I replace the cartridges?
Every 6–12 months, depending on your water quality and usage. Replace sooner if you notice a change in taste, odour, or water flow.
Do I need bypass valves?
Bypass valves aren't included and we don't stock them, but we strongly recommend your plumber fit them on either side of the system. They let you isolate the unit for servicing without cutting off your water supply. Any licensed plumber or plumbing merchant can supply and fit them.
